摘要: 使用贝叶斯网络模型进行威胁评估是一种比较新的定量分析方法。将分层贝叶斯网络模型应用于航母编队对潜艇编队威胁评估,评估潜艇编队的威胁等级,达到为航母编队指挥员反潜作战提供辅助决策的目的。对分层贝叶斯网络模型进行阐述。分析了航母编队面对来自水下目标威胁产生的原因和机理,综合部队数据、院校专家、查阅资料基础上构建了可靠的航母编队分层贝叶斯网络。通过实验仿真对比实践部队数据验证了分层贝叶斯网络对航母编队威胁评估的有效性。

Abstract: The use of bayesian network model for threat assessment is a relatively new quantitative analysis method. The hierarchical bayesian network model was applied to aircraft carrier formation to assess submarine formation threat for the first time, which also assessed the threat level of the submarine formation, to achieve the purpose of assisting decision-making for aircraft carrier formation commanders in anti-submarine warfare. The hierarchical bayesian network model was described. The causes and the mechanism of the aircraft carrier formation from the underwater target threat, integrated force data, institutional experts and information were analyzed. A reliable aircraft carrier formation hierarchical bayesian network was established. The effectiveness of the hierarchical bayesian network on the threat assessment of aircraft carrier formation was verified by the experimental simulation.
